Systems Research Engineer, GPU Programming

Together AI

San Francisco, CA · full time

$160,000 – $230,000

What this role is

A role developing and optimizing GPU kernels and machine learning algorithms with teams across modeling, hardware and software. This suits researchers and engineers with deep GPU programming expertise who want to work on AI infrastructure at the cutting edge.

What they ask for

Required

  • Strong background in GPU programming and parallel computing (CUDA and/or Triton)
  • Knowledge of ML/AI applications and models
  • Knowledge of performance profiling and optimization tools for GPU programming
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
  • Bachelor's, Master's, or Ph.D. deg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or equivalent practical experience
